To certify for the E2 visa, you must spend, or remain in the procedure of investing, a considerable quantity of capital in a United States company.
For funding extensive organizations, the E2 visa minimum investment quantity can vary from thousands of thousands to numerous dollars - E2 Visa. Conversely, for organizations that are not capital intensive, financial investments of $100,000 or much less might be enough. Inevitably, the financial investment should be large sufficient to make certain the success of the E2 service
Simply depositing funds right into a financial institution account is not enough to reveal that the financial investment goes to danger and does not meet the financial investment demand. Being in the initial stage of authorizing agreements or browsing for suitable places and residential or commercial properties does not fulfill the financial investment need. Likewise, inheriting a service does not constitute a financial investment for purposes of E2 visa.

Little joint endeavors might likewise certify as E2 businesses, supplied that at least 50% is owned by a person of a treaty country. You can remain in the United States forever via unrestricted visa revivals or two-years condition extensions, offered that you remain to meet the E2 read more demands. There is no cap on the variety of revivals or expansions you can make an application for.
As an example, the optimum validity period for an E2 investor visa issued to a Mexican resident is four years based on upgraded visa terms effective since 2020. Conversely, for residents of the majority of European nations, the E2 visa legitimacy is 2 to five years, with specific exemptions. However, also if your E2 visa stands for 5 years, it does not suggest that you can stay in the United States for the whole five year duration without interruption.
Each time you go into the US with an E2 visa, you are given two years of status. This implies you can remain in the country for two consecutive years during a single remain. To prolong your remain, you can either request a standing expansion from USCIS or depart from the United States and re-enter to obtain an extra 2 years of status.
